NovaCentrix Metalon JS-A101A is an electrically conductive ink designed to produce circuits on porous and non-porous substrates such as coated papers and polymeric films including polycarbonate and PET. This ink can be thermally cured at temperatures as low as 100°C or PulseForge® processed for enhanced conductivity. The ink is formulated for printing from the Dimatix Samba printhead and various thermal inkjet printheads such as those manufactured by HP. It is a water-based silver nanoparticle inkjet ink, suitable for Piezo (Samba, KM, others), and thermal HP inkjet heads on porous and nonporous substrates, such as plastics and paper (requires PulseForge® curing).
